Late May for valles de trubia will be great in terms of temperature. You may catch, thougth, a bad spell of weather and have a lot of rain. There are, however, same places that you can still climb, but probably not in the grades you are looking for.
The other advantage of late May is that it is outside the main holiday season so less people. It may be a bit hot to climb in the sun if the weather is particularly hot, but if this happens you have a lot of areas with shade, at least some part of the day.
If you go be sure to visit Marabio, for climbing or just sightseeing day or night. It is a really nice place.
